WebFeb 14, 2024 · catherine wheel stitch in the round Written Instructions Round 1: Ch 4 and join with a slst to first ch to form a ring. [Ch 3. 4 dc CL. Ch 3. Slst in center of ring] four times. Round 2: Ch 1. [12 dc in loop that closed next CL. Slst in next slst] four times. Round 3: Slst first 4 sts. [Ch 3. 4 dc CL. Ch 3. Slst in next slst.
